NVO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

1,663 of the 7,592 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Novo Nordisk (NVO)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$30.2B — down 24% from $39.7B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 291 funds closed out of NVO and 208 opened new positions — a net loss of 83 holders — while 641 trimmed existing stakes and 600 added.

The largest buyer was GQG Partners, adding an estimated $601M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$855M.
